Providing incentives for reviews or asking for them selectively can bias the TrustScore, which works against our tips. THC vape pens are products that help you inhale vapor made up of tetrahydrocannabinol (THC). THC could be the compound in cannabis that offers the high experience. The internet site is not https://thccartsstore.co.uk/product-category/torch-disposables/